Whether you are a professional birder, nature enthusiast, or just want
to learn more about Rouge Park and its birds, you are invited to
participate in the Second Annual Rouge Park Winter Bird Count on
Sunday January 9, 2005. The count encompasses a large section of the
Parks diverse and environmentally significant landscapes in the Rouge
River watershed including portions of Markham and eastern Toronto.
Experienced birders are needed to lead groups as captains. Volunteers
are also needed to count birds in the backyards of their own homes and

Cranberry Marsh
Ontario, Canada
Daily Raptor Counts: Nov 19, 2004
-------------------------------------------------------------------
Species Day's Count Month Total Season Total
------------------ ----------- -------------- --------------
Black Vulture 0 0 0
Turkey Vulture 0 33 1174
Osprey 0 0 116
Bald Eagle 0 1 39
Northern Harrier 2 25 126
Sharp-shinned Hawk 0 28 918
Cooper's Hawk 0 18 105
Northern Goshawk 0 10 23
Red-shouldered Hawk 0 1 19
Broad-winged Hawk 0 0 895
Red-tailed Hawk 2 475 1000
Rough-legged Hawk 1 201 312
Golden Eagle 0 2 9
American Kestrel 0 2 448
Merlin 0 4 44
Peregrine Falcon 0 0 30
Unknown 0 10 130
Gyrfalcon 0 0 0
Total: 5 810 5388
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Observation start time: 08:00:00
Observation end time: 13:00:00
Total observation time: 5 hours
Official Counter: Doug Lockrey
Observers: Bill Scott, Del Umholtz, Jan Slumkoski, Karl Jennewein
Visitors:
20 from various parts of Ontario
Weather:
calm day; steady BP; TUV=100 ft./min.; 11C;
Observations:
2 N.Harrier, 2 Red-tailed, 1 Rough-legged
Golden-crowned Sparrow---day 13 (every 60 min. or so)
